异丙肾上腺素对离体大鼠心脏功能和能量代谢的作用随时间而部分丧失。

Time dependent partial loss of the effects of isoproterenol on function and energy metabolism of isolated rat hearts.

作者信息

Giesen J, Sondermann M, Juengling E, Kammermeier H

出版信息

Basic Res Cardiol. 1980 Jul-Aug;75(4):515-25. doi: 10.1007/BF01907833.

DOI:10.1007/BF01907833
PMID:7436995
Abstract

In isolated perfused rat hearts (medium: Krebs-Ringer solution containing about 15% bovine red cells) the following parameters were estimated: heart rate (F), left intraventricular peak pressure (P), dP/dt, oxygen consumption (VO2); myocardial tissue content of glycogen, ATP, ADP, AMP, cAMP, phosphocreatin (PC) and inorganic phosphate (Pi). Isoproterenol (ISO) was administered to the non circulating system in the concentration range of 5 x 10(-10) to 5 x 10(-5) M for 4 min and 1 hour respectively by infusion into the perfusate close to the aortic canula. After administration period of 4 min dependent on the concentration of ISO, P, dP/dt, VO2 and the content of cAMP are increased. The ratios of PC/Pi and ATP/ADP as well as glycogen content are reduced. For an administration period of 1 hour at a level of 5 x 10(-9) M the effects of isoproterenol are maintained. At ISO concentration higher than 5 x 10(-9) M the effects on mechanical parameters and VO2 fall to the level of those values which are produced at 5 x 10(-9) M ISO. In contrast, high energy phosphates and glycogen content remain reduced while that of cAMP is elevated.

摘要

在离体灌注大鼠心脏(介质:含约15%牛红细胞的 Krebs-Ringer 溶液)中,测定了以下参数:心率(F)、左心室内峰压(P)、dP/dt、耗氧量(VO₂);心肌组织中糖原、三磷酸腺苷(ATP)、二磷酸腺苷(ADP)、一磷酸腺苷(AMP)、环磷酸腺苷(cAMP)、磷酸肌酸(PC)和无机磷酸盐(Pi)的含量。分别以5×10⁻¹⁰至5×10⁻⁵ M 的浓度,通过向靠近主动脉插管处的灌注液中输注异丙肾上腺素(ISO)4分钟和1小时,将其给予非循环系统。给药4分钟后,根据 ISO 的浓度,P、dP/dt、VO₂和 cAMP 的含量增加。PC/Pi 和 ATP/ADP 的比值以及糖原含量降低。在5×10⁻⁹ M 的水平给药1小时,异丙肾上腺素的作用得以维持。当 ISO 浓度高于5×10⁻⁹ M 时,对机械参数和 VO₂的作用降至在5×10⁻⁹ M ISO 时产生的水平。相反,高能磷酸盐和糖原含量仍然降低,而 cAMP 的含量升高。
